The person hired for this position of Director, Global Trade Compliance Counsel will provide subject‑matter expertise and legal advice to Arrow and its global trade compliance organization regarding U.S. and international trade laws, including import and export controls, sanctions, antiboycott laws, and export licensing. In addition, the Director will lead the global trade compliance organization. This full‑time position is located in Centennial, CO.

What You’ll Be Doing

Monitor U.S. and foreign export regulations for potential applicability to Arrow.

Provide advice and counsel on trade compliance matters, including activities related to U.S. and international sanctions regimes, the Harmonized Tariff Schedule, customs federal regulations, NAFTA, entry processes, valuation, and informed compliance methods.

Advise on export licensing and other authorizations, coordinating with business leadership to identify compliant solutions.

Provide guidance on State and Commerce Department export license applications, Commodity Jurisdictions, Advisory Opinions, Commodity Classifications, and other export compliance documents.

Respond promptly to requests from internal clients and summarize and clearly communicate legal risks.

Collaborate with business units, Arrow legal colleagues, external counsel, and corporate departments to assure compliance with applicable international trade regulations worldwide, while achieving strategic and operational objectives, by counseling on trade issues, policy, procedures, training, and communications.

Conduct general review of business contract terms and conditions concerning trade compliance.

Lead a large global team.
